Brackvenn Moor Ponds

Highlight • Lake

In the area of the Brackvenn near Mützenich there are always wonderfully situated moor lakes, some of which, the so-called Palsas (Palses), are witnesses to the Ice Age.

Rur Islands near Monschau

Highlight • River

Part of the really wild Rur valley section below the Ehrensteinley are the large boulders and debris deposits as well as the small islands.
